Berlin - The Pentecost weekend was perfect this year - at least from a weather point of view. Hundreds of rubber boats met on the Landwehr Canal in Berlin. Despite Corona *, distance rules seemed forgotten. The police had to intervene. This was about a protest, about the support of Berlin clubs.

Water demo in Berlin: 400 rubber boats crowded on the Landwehr Canal

The Berlin police said that the meeting took place on the water from Alt-Treptow to Kreuzberg under the theme "For culture - everyone in one boat". Around 12.30 p.m. the water demo started on Saturday (May 31st). Initially, the boats started to move, accompanied by two boats from the water police. But over time, more and more boats joined. 

In the end, the police counted up to 400 boats , including mostly inflatables and around 20 larger boats. Around 1,500 people attended the meeting on the water and also on the shore.

The organizer asked the participants several times to keep the distances, the police said. Rescue workers also addressed the boat drivers and participants on the bank. "Due to the non-compliance with each other and complaints about too loud music," the organizer ended the water demo in the early evening in consultation with the police. The police were deployed with 100 forces.

Because of corona rules: Violent criticism against Berlin demo on the water

The campaign against the dying of the club scene and rave culture in Berlin caused criticism. It can be seen in photos and videos of the party that hardly anyone adheres to the distance rules. Hardly anyone wore mouth-and-nose protection at the meeting. The reactions on Twitter followed promptly.

According to the Berlin Club Commission, it was an initiative by individual actors from the club scene. The original plan was for people on the banks of the Spree to listen to music and speeches from boats on the water. According to rbb24.de , the organizers had hardly expected the crowd. The organizers apologized for the techno party in front of the clinical center on Urban, that this location was more than poorly chosen as the end point of the demo and was symbolically completely inappropriate. 

Risk of corona virus spread: Call to demonstrators

In the statement, the Berlin Club Commission asks the risk of spread of all participants of the demo coronavirus limit to prevent and their social contacts in the next 14 days to a minimum - especially when dealing with older and sick people.

Despite violations of the corona distance regulation: No consequences for organizers

The organizers of the demo should not fear any consequences. Emergency workers would have neither posted reports about the corona violations , nor recorded personal data, reports rbb24.de
